Game of Thrones is an American fantasy drama television series which is an adaptation of A Song of Ice and Fire, a series of fantasy novels by George R. R. Martin. It is the first piece of media within the World of Westeros series, premiering in 2011 and concluding in 2019. A prequel series, House of the Dragon, premiered on HBO in 2022. Drogon is a male dragon belonging to Daenerys Targaryen and the eldest brother of Rhaegal and Viserion. He is the largest of her three dragons, as well as the most spirited and aggressive. As such, Daenerys has problems keeping him in control, despite seeing him as her "son". Daenerys Targaryen went to the House of the Undying on the second season finale and was shown a vision of the destroyed Red Keep and snow falling on the Iron Throne. In this vision, Daenerys never touched the throne and instead turned toward a symbol of death.
